#27802d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#27802d is composed of 15.3% red, 50.2% green and 17.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 69.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 64.8% yellow and 49.8% black. It has a hue angle of 124 degrees, a saturation of 53.3% and a lightness of 32.7%. #27802d color hex could be obtained by blending #4eff5a with #000100.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

● #27802d color description : Dark moderate lime green.
#27802d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#27802d has RGB values of R:39, G:128, B:45 and CMYK values of C:0.7, M:0, Y:0.65, K:0.5. Its decimal value is 2588717.

Shades and Tints of #27802d
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020803 is the darkest color, while #f8fdf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#27802d
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4e594e is the less saturated color, while #00a70c is the most saturated one.
